**11-Year-Old Drill Rapper Sentenced to Seven Years for Shooting One-Year-Old**

In a troubling incident that has captured national attention, an 11-year-old aspiring drill rapper from Fort Worth, Texas, has been sentenced to seven years in a juvenile detention facility after being found guilty of accidentally shooting a one-year-old child. The young rapper, known as Lil Rodney, was already on probation for a previous arson charge when the shooting occurred.

The shooting incident reportedly took place earlier this year, when Rodney, who had been fitted with an ankle monitor due to his prior arrest, removed the device without permission. During a court appearance, he expressed remorse and pleaded for another chance, explaining that he had wanted to attend a friend’s funeral. However, he was unable to provide the name of the deceased friend, raising questions about the legitimacy of his claims.

The circumstances surrounding the shooting remain unclear, but law enforcement officials indicated that the gun was fired accidentally while Rodney was allegedly playing with it. Fortunately, the one-year-old child survived the incident, a fact that has been met with relief by the community.

Judge Kim, who presided over Rodney’s case, noted the severity of the situation, emphasizing the importance of accountability, especially given the young rapper’s history of criminal behavior. This latest incident comes as part of a troubling pattern for Rodney, who has faced legal issues at a young age and was previously involved in a serious arson case.

The case has sparked discussions about the challenges facing young people in troubled environments and the systemic issues that can lead to such tragic outcomes. Rodney’s mother, who had him at the age of 16, has faced her own legal troubles and has admitted to being incarcerated during her son’s childhood. This raises concerns about the familial and social context that may have influenced Rodney’s actions.
